In a circuit arrangement for limiting the switching-on current peaks in a switching transistor (T), for example, a switching transistor in a direct voltage converter, rectangular switching pulses of the same height (UST) are applied to the control input of the switching transistor. In order to protect, for the largest possible number of types of application, the switching transistor (T) having an equally dimensioned coil (PW) from overload, the coil is included in a branch which is common both to the control circuit and to the operating circuit of the switching transistor. For simultaneously monitoring the operating current (I) in a direct voltage converter (UB, UA), the coil is the primary coil of a current transformer (STW), whose secondary circuit includes, inter alia, the series-combination of a saturable choke (DR) and a load resistor (RB2). The proportioning of all elements (RB1, DR, RB2, SW) in the secondary circuit of the current converter transformer can be chosen so that the voltage drop at the load resistor (RB2) is a measure of the current strength (i) through the switching transistor. When this voltage drop exceeds a threshold, the switching transistor is cut off by a pulse width modulator (PWM) until the next switching pulse occurs.
